Noises... Ugh
My car was in for the noise in the right rear of the car. They cleaned and lubricated the bushings and caps. The car was gone for one week. I got it back and the noise is much worse than before. I can't stand to drive it. The noise is obnoxious and constant. The car goes back Tuesday and I will take the shop foreman for a ride so he hears what I hear. I told them about the strut replacement and they were not to interested. Wish me luck.

The car was back in this week. The big noise was a latch in the rear hatch. They did hear another noise in the back of the car. They have ordered a new rear strut and will install it. The service writer said Mercedes controls the flow of fixes. They can be stubborn in Deutschland. Hopefully this gets me down to one or two creaks and noises. I would normally trade the car in and move on, but I want to give this GTs some more time.
